One of the biggest advantages of these devices is their ability to automate complex monitoring processes. Instead of relying on manual sample collection, intelligent systems continuously gather environmental data and analyze it automatically. This reduces human error and improves the speed of microbial detection.
Artificial intelligence is also playing a significant role in enhancing these systems. AI algorithms can analyze large datasets generated by germ collectors and identify patterns related to contamination events. This predictive capability helps organizations implement preventive measures more effectively.

What is an Intelligent Germs Collector?
An intelligent germs collector is a device designed to capture and analyze airborne or surface microbes automatically, helping organizations monitor environmental hygiene and detect contamination risks.
Why is the Intelligent Germs Collector Market growing?
The market is expanding due to increasing awareness about infection control, advancements in sensor technologies, and rising demand for automated hygiene monitoring solutions in healthcare and industrial facilities.
Where are intelligent germ collectors commonly used?
They are used in hospitals, pharmaceutical cleanrooms, laboratories, food processing facilities, and public infrastructure where maintaining sterile environments is critical.
How do these systems improve infection prevention?
They provide continuous monitoring, automated sampling, and faster detection of harmful microbes, allowing organizations to take preventive action quickly.
